Residents Protest Maintenance Issues

Residents of Greater Noida's Golf Links 1 society took to the streets in a protest highlighting the ongoing issues related to maintenance. The demonstration, prompted by residents' dissatisfaction with the current state of affairs, emphasises the need for urgent attention to address the persistent problems within the residential complex.

Protestors raised concerns over various maintenance lapses, encompassing issues such as inadequate upkeep of common areas, infrastructure concerns, and a perceived lack of responsiveness to residents' complaints. The demonstration aims to draw the management's and authorities' attention to the grievances of the community, seeking immediate and effective solutions.

The residents' collective action underscores the significance of maintaining a high standard of living within residential societies and the importance of responsive management to address concerns promptly. The protest also sheds light on the vital role of effective maintenance practices in ensuring the well-being and satisfaction of the residents.

The authorities are urged to engage with the residents, actively listen to their grievances, and work collaboratively to implement corrective measures. This protest serves as a reminder of the essential partnership between residents and management in fostering a harmonious and well-maintained living environment in Greater Noida's Golf Links 1 society.
